Output 52d273f69be73af4af57a64820667e53941de70a4c3c39f46aab8520981c19ef:27

value
19780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f24e715d50cc263703403a521728f17220b1dc8 OP_EQUAL
address
37Sthfvu2YDsJH7ZnCnxsppgFt4cEteDJQ
transaction
52d273f69be73af4af57a64820667e53941de70a4c3c39f46aab8520981c19ef